Montemagno may refer to:

Places

Italy
  • Montemagno, Piedmont, a comune (municipality) in the Province of Asti
  • Montemagno, Pisa, a village in the comune of Calci in the Province of Pisa, Tuscany
  • Montemagno, Lucca, in the Province of Lucca, Tuscany
